React.js has also won the hearts of software developers, expanding its worldwide community. According to the recent Stack Overflow Developer Survey, it is now the second most loved web framework.
The pantheon of the world’s most recognized companies that entrusted React.js is also very impressive, just to name Facebook and Instagram, Pinterest, and Airbnb. Explore the benefits of React.js that made it such a desired web framework.
React.js Development Benefits
React.js is praised for its versatility and high performance.
React.js is one of the most loved web frameworks, being appreciated by 68.9% of the respondents.
What is possible?
Explore the possibilities of React.js
What makes React.js scalable?
React.js was developed by Facebook back in 2013 and since then it has created a devoted community of software developers and companies.
A big chunk of this popularity is how scalable web apps built with React.js are. This scalability is due to the component-based architecture. These reusable components represent each part of the UI, and once the component is created, it can be used for a similar purpose within the web application. Software developers can also use open-source libraries of prebuilt components.
This approach significantly reduces the time needed to develop an app, but also makes it more scalable, as developers only need to create new components or use the existing ones to add new features.
What is React.js used for?
Web applications created with React.js are also very efficient. This makes it a good choice for web services that rely on providing high-performing products to their users. React.js has been primarily used by Facebook and Instagram, quickly becoming popular among other web applications.
Today, the library is present in the code of products like Netflix, WhatsApp, Codeacademy, Dropbox, and Airbnb.
Choose a team that fits your project
Choosing React.js development services for your next project, you need a team of React developers ready to take your app to the next level.
Depending on your project size and your own in-house capabilities, you can decide to fully outsource your project to a software house or choose an extended team model. The latter is an alternative to outsourcing, based on hiring only the specialists you lack to join your own team.
Regardless of the model of cooperation you choose, we will keep you in a loop, ensuring ongoing communication and progress reports, allowing you to remain in full control of your app’s development.
React.js development process
We follow a proven process to deliver your project.
Analyse, understand, clarify.
Constantly help and improve.
The cost of React.js development
If you’re not sure about the details of your app architecture, software development team can also help you with this, as well as with choosing the right tech stack for your project.
We’re your team of React developers
At SoftwareHut, we’re a team of 200+ experienced software developers, ready to deliver your React.js application. With over 200 projects delivered for our clients, we know our craft when it comes to bespoke software development.
We’re an extended team, which means we can join your project at any time, working hand-in-hand with your in-house software developers. You don’t have a team? No worries, we take on entire projects, too.
We use the best tech on the market
What our clients say about us
Without the help of SoftwareHut we would not have been able to scale as quickly as we did.
SoftwareHut delivered a quality product, resulting in an ongoing partnership. The skill level and quality of work is fantastic as well as the responsiveness for requests. They're worth every penny.
The code delivered by SoftwareHut contributed to increased sales
Their team was well organized and disciplined, delivering exactly what was requested within the timeline and price point that they promised.
They’ve demonstrated their agility every time we had a new requirement
Under high pressure, they were quick to produce a great product, piling together resources at an impressive rate. As their amazing efficiency did not compromise the quality of their work, they've secured future collaboration.
Need more time to dig into React.js?
Take a look at our articles on this subject.
Shoes from Abibas, t-shirts from CAP, briefs from Ghlain Klain… There are no limits to counterfeiters’ imagination. Whatever product you can think of, there’s a high chance its knockoffs are
Before describing the role of Project Manager in software development company, I want to start with a quick introduction to the Scrum Guide. In a nutshell, Scrum is an agile
To my loyal, devoted, and emboldened hackers, this is our golden age. Just last year – if you were to tell me that I would create the world’s most prolific,
Do you have any questions?
We’ve covered some of the most frequently asked questions to make the decision easier for you.
Vue.js and React are both popular web frameworks. Although React is used more often, the employment of Vue.js is also on the rise.
How do they differ?
- Vue.js is a JS framework, great for both small and complex projects. It is easier to adopt by a team of developers and makes for a fast software project development. It can be successfully used for rapid development of lightweight apps.
What is similar? Both frameworks:
- utilize a virtual DOM
- provide reactive and composable view components
maintain focus in the core library, with concerns such as routing and global state management handled by companion libraries.
Who uses React.js?
One of the advantages of using React.js is its maintainability and scalability. This makes it a good option for both small projects and worldwide applications.
Top companies using Vue.js in their projects include: